Hotel on the Corner of Bitter and Sweet is an historical novel by Jamie Ford. The plot centers around the forced evacuation of Japanese Americans to internment camps; the book depicts the pain and trauma of separation through the friendship of the Chinese-American Henry and his Japanese-American friend Keiko.

You are driving on a two lane highway at night, using your low beam headlights because of nearby traffic. You should
s344n2d4d5 [400]
When there is oncoming traffic on a two lane highway at night, you should always use your low beam headlights. High beams can be used when there is not any traffic coming towards you. When there is approaching traffic coming towards you, make sure to turn the high beams off.

Washington Irving's collective book of "Tales of a Traveler" includes the section of "The Adventures of the Mysterious Picture". This story deals with the strange, somewhat horror story of a group of travelers staying in a mansion of one of their friends.

This group were then told by their host that there is a haunted chamber but it will be seen whose room was the next morning. They will have to wait to see who the hero of the night will be. This story is infused with elements or horror, with the narrator of the story unable to sleep peacefully in the chamber allotted to him.
